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Stockport to Maybole start from as little as £25.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Stockport to Maybole start from £75.70 one way, or £108.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Stockport to Maybole are available for £80.50 one way, or £161.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Stockport Station

Ensuring that your travel is as smooth as possible, Stockport Station offers a wide range of facilities. For those looking to purchase and collect tickets, the ticket office is open from early morning until late evening. Additionally, there are numerous ticket machines available, with accessible options provided, ensuring convenience for all travelers. You'll also find a smartcard validator to streamline your journey.

The station is keen on providing comprehensive help and support for its travelers. Staff assistance is available throughout the station, with help points strategically located should you need any guidance. Departures and arrivals are clearly announced and displayed on screens, so you're always up to date. While there is no luggage storage available, CCTV monitors the premises continuously for your safety.

Step-Free Access and Support

Accessibility is a priority at Stockport Station. You will find step-free access throughout the entire station, including lifts to all platforms via the station subway. Accessible features such as induction loops, ramps for train access, and accessible ticket machines ensure that everyone can travel comfortably. Unfortunately, there are no accessible taxis or spaces in the parking lot, but an impaired mobility set-down/pick-up point is available.

Refreshments, Shopping, and More

For those waiting at the station or just passing through, you'll find a variety of refreshment options like Starbucks on Platform 2 and Pumpkin on Platform 3/4. There are shops available for a quick purchase, though currency exchange isn't provided. An ATM is conveniently situated at the station front.

While there isn't a First-Class lounge, waiting rooms are located on several platforms, so you can rest comfortably while waiting for your train. Free public Wi-Fi isn’t yet available, but payphones are on hand should you need to make a call.

Facilities and Amenities

While Maybole station presents a quaint and simple set-up, it ensures a smooth experience for travelers. Although there is no ticket office or machine for online ticket collections, the advent of smart technology offers a way forward with smartcard validators present at the station. Assistance is always a step away with the help point available for on-the-spot information, providing updates through screens and announcements.

Accessibility is key at Maybole station, featuring a step-free access throughout the premises, ensuring ease of movement for all visitors. However, for those requiring assistance, it's worth noting the station doesn't provide additional staff help or accessible facilities like toilets or waiting rooms. However, you can make prior arrangements utilizing the Passenger Assist service to enhance your travel comfort.

Onward Travel from Maybole

For those envisioning continued explorations beyond Maybole, the station connects travelers with several transport options. Local buses conveniently pick up and drop off passengers at the nearby Culzean Road bus stop, accessible from the station entrance. As for taxis, details for available hires are just a click away on platforms like Traintaxi.

If you're planning on further adventures using bus services, Traveline Scotland offers comprehensive information and schedules for seamless planning.
